The story of the hero in Wagner\u2019s \u201cTannh\u00e4user\u201d originated in a German \u201cVolksbuch\u201d (\u201cpeople\u2019s book,\u201d a kind of chapbook) of the 18th century. In the legend, a minnesinger was tempted to a life of pleasure in the Venus Grotto because of the beautiful goddess. Originally this title-hero could have been a medieval minnesinger (ca. 1245-1265). In this report, I will analyze the love songs he performed at court and search for the reason why the character was later obsessed with the goddess Venus. Moreover, I would like to consider the same character in Hans Sachs\u2019s carnival play \u201cThe Court of Venus\u201d (1517). In this play, we can see that the character of Tannh\u00e4user is a hedonist.\u00a0 On the other hand, the title hero of the Wagner opera seeks the salvation of God. Through the interpretation of three sorts of characters of Tannh\u00e4user, I intend to reveal a more accurate intention of Wagner.<\/li>\n<li>Profile of Presenter: Michiko Ishii studies German literature with a research focus on medieval Germany and its influence on future generations.
